What's The Definition Of Day-laborer?
[n] a laborer who works by the day; for daily wages
Synonyms | Synonyms for Day-laborer: day labourer Related Terms | Find terms related to Day-laborer: See Also | jack | laborer | labourer | manual laborer Day-laborer In Webster's Dictionary \Day"-la`bor*er\, n.
One who works by the day; -- usually applied to a farm
laborer, or to a workman who does not work at any particular
trade. --Goldsmith.
